Sharing my starter macro on how I would tank as WAR with /MNK on lower levels.
-Consider the party set-up- This may not be viable if you have a nuke happy player.

/ja “Provoke” <bt> (or <t>)
/wait 15 sec
/ja “Boost” <me>
/wait 15 sec
/ja “Provoke” <bt> (or <t>)
/wait 15 sec
/ja “Boost” <me>

Any time I make macros for any job, I have a set of standards:


(Anything written after ## means that it is a comment, i.e. not part of the macro.)

Job abilities, magic, and anything that targets enemies:

+++ ## assist for alliances, high mob areas, dynamis, etc.
/assist <stpc>

ABILITY ## or main spell, etc
/equipset set#
/recast "Job Ability" ## If longer than a few seconds
/echo [Spell] cost: x mp ** <mp> ## of course only for spells, and only if it's 50+ mp or whatever
/ja "Job ability" <stnpc> ## I like to do things manually. If you need to just check recast, you can cancel out,
## i.e. for equipset only
## of course, use <stpc> for friendly, <st> if you need to be able to target both pc and npc


**str/dex/etc ## for stat mod ws
/equipset set#
/ws "Weapon skill" <stnpc> ## The pattern here is I prefer to have the option to cancel out of my macros

**element ## for weaponskill with elemental damage
/equipset set#
/ws "Weapon skill" <stnpc>

!non-battle-command
/map ## or whatever command you need

--range
/ra <stnpc>

(INC)
/p ***Incoming*** <lastst> ***Incoming***

You should not voke whenever you can. You should voke when it is needed. Also usually if you press a different macro it should stop the /wait of your voke macro. That means you can only use that macro then. I think that is how it was on retail at least I think. That is why you can't really do something like a Sleep reminder for Sleep spell. Other macros will interrupt it.

hey dont forget you can put waits on the end of your macros i.e /ja provoke <bt> <wait 3> ; /ja boost <me> instead of /ja provoke <bt> ; /wait 3 ; /ja boost <me>

Yeah Warrior is usually a backup voke only. PLD and NIN are the ones who have to voke constantly and WAR only if BLM or other mages pull off of them. If you're main tanking, you should probably be voking every single time.
